"This is a fairly straightforward climb in a beautiful area of Waterton Park.
We started the day at Red Rocks canyon, which was deserted at our early start time...a rare treat!
We followed the snowshoe trail for 4-5 km, until we reached the Goat Lake turnoff. This is doubletrack, and very easy going. We needed to cross two drainages coming down from Glendowan, and they were flowing. One had a makeshift bridge, and the other was an easy rock-hop. No issues.
The trail to goat lake covers elevation quickly, but it is nicely graded. It is mostly snow free until the waterfall, with the exception of one easily crossed gully (which may make beginner hikers uneasy). There was snow around the lake and campground, and this continued for the next couple hundred vertical meters. The hiking trail to Avion Ride/Newmand Col was burred until the top, but the direction of travel is obvious. Snow was hip deep, and mostly, but not totally supportive. We found easy routes through the two rockbands (falls) above the lake, though neither were "official". Once above the snow, we quickly made our way to the official trail...the scree here is NOT good for climbing, so the trail really helps.
